Driver and Crane Operator T5 CANCUN

Company: Alstom

Job Title: Driver and Crane Operator

Purpose of the Job: To drive trucks with platforms with loads and operate crane within the tracks and highways.

Position in the Organization: DIS / Installation. Direct reporting: PrYM. Key Network & Links: Installation Supervisor / Site Coordinator / PrYM / Field Operation Manager.

Responsibilities
  • Lifting and download equipment maneuvers.
  • Able to understand and dominate Weight – Volume – Distance – High lift procedure table.
  • Keep the truck and Crane in optimal condition by reporting any mechanical failure and attending the maintenance services needed.
  • Safetiness, Quality, EHS, RSA (Railway Safety).
  • Good Attitude.
  • Time Availability.
  • Binnacle Control (use and gasoline consumption).
  • Assure Railway Safety all the time.
  • Deliver and handle equipment and materials in time and secure.
  • Ensure compliance with EHS procedures.
  • Report any vehicle issue and failures.
  • Capable of making simple electrical or mechanical repairs.
  • Transfer of material and equipment.
  • Operate and handle the crane for lifting materials and equipment.
  • Transit Rules Fulfillment.
  • Deliver custom materials like drum cables and any tool and heavy equipment.
  • Fill checklist and documentation delivery.
